The SYLBR Story
SYLBR is more than just a funding initiative; it's a movement. OneUp recognized the challenges faced by local race organizers and decided to step in with a simple yet powerful solution: t-shirts. By providing organizers with high-quality shirts to sell, SYLBR helps fund grassroots racing and events, ensuring that communities can come together to celebrate their love for cycling.
What makes this particularly fascinating is the initiative's inclusivity. While the name suggests a focus on racing, SYLBR welcomes all types of community cycling events, from enduros to pump track sessions and classic XC races. It's a true celebration of the diverse cycling community.
Impact and Growth
Since its launch in 2025, SYLBR has made a significant impact. Over 300 shirts have been delivered to event organizers, raising thousands of dollars for local riding communities. The program started close to home in Canada but has quickly expanded its reach, supporting events in the United States, Ireland, and Scotland. And the growth doesn't stop there.
For 2026, OneUp aims to add another 20 organizations to the SYLBR family, extending its support worldwide. This expansion is a testament to the initiative's success and its ability to unite cycling enthusiasts globally.
